As nouns, ethics is a hypernym of sense of right and wrong; that is, ethics is a word with a broader meaning than sense of right and wrong:
  • sense of right and wrong: motivation deriving logically from ethical or moral principles that govern a person's thoughts and actions
  • ethics: motivation based on ideas of right and wrong
Other hypernyms of sense of right and wrong include ethical motive, morality, morals.
